Abstract

1414098 Coated products G T SHUTT 15 Aug 1973 [17 Aug 1972] 38636/73 Heading B2E In a method for the preparation of a coated ferrous metal substrate, a polymerisable compound, a filler which is not anodic with respect to the substrate and an ionisable compound capable of dissolving in moisture to form a corrosive electrolytic solution are mixed and applied to a ferrous metal substrate and the polymerisable compound is polymerised such that the resultant polymer and filler together form a firm porous coating adhered to the ferrous metal substrate and containing the ionisable compound. Preferred polymerisable compounds are alkyl silicates, acrylic resins, urethane resins and styrene resins. Inert fillers are preferably silica, talc, mica, kaolin, bentonite, asbestos, fireclay, clay impurities, aluminium oxide or zirconium oxide. Active fillers specified are carbon, ferric oxide, copper, copper oxide, cadmium, cadmium oxide, tin, tin oxide, titanium oxide and chromium oxide. Suitable ionisable compounds are inorganic and organic salts of many metals and organic bases e.g. calcium hydrogen phosphate and guanidine chromate. Examples describe the preferred coatings in which silicate esters are used together with metal oxides or salts.
